Hyderabad: Truck driver, supervisor held in hit-and-run case

Hyderabad: The Chandanagar police on Friday arrested a truck driver and a supervisor in a hit-and-run case of a BHEL employee at Serilingampally last week. They were booked under culpable homicide not amounting to murder, police said.

On June 5 morning, the suspect Chotu Munda drove the truck in a rash and negligent manner and hit the scooter of Shahid Abdullah (35) of Bandlaguda. Abdullah fell on the road and died on the spot due to grievous bleeding injuries.


The supervisor, D Santosh Varma, though having clear knowledge that heavy motor vehicles are not allowed to move in the city between 6 am and 3 pm, and also knowing clearly that it was dangerous and can cause serious accidents, allowed the truck. The duo was produced before the court and remanded in judicial custody.

The Cyberabad Traffic Police urged the drivers and owners of heavy transport vehicles to educate themselves about traffic rules and regulations regularly in view of road safety.
